FAQs on the 14 times table

The 14 times table is a mathematical table that lists the products of 14 and positive integers up to a certain limit. The table starts with 14 × 1 = 14, and each subsequent row lists the product of 14 and the next integer. The table usually goes up to 10 or 12.

Here’s the full 14 times table:

  • 14 × 1 = 14
  • 14 × 2 = 28
  • 14 × 3 = 42
  • 14 × 4 = 56
  • 14 × 5 = 70
  • 14 × 6 = 84
  • 14 × 7 = 98
  • 14 × 8 = 112
  • 14 × 9 = 126
  • 14 × 10 = 140

The multiples of 14 are numbers that can be evenly divided by 14. Some of the first few multiples of 14 are:

14, 28, 42, 56, 70, 84, 98, 112, 126, 140, …

In general, to find the nth multiple of 14, you can multiply 14 by n.
